Output 39336e3f464898d10ded8af1851ec3952571c9d80f813fb88c54e8754c6498bf:7

value
2351771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d88aeae759937955a9f38452870ddab9bcb776fc OP_EQUAL
address
3MRzJ9ECxXfQKQKgu4U9cvBqR6zf7B9MJ5
transaction
39336e3f464898d10ded8af1851ec3952571c9d80f813fb88c54e8754c6498bf
spent
true